Japan heat a 'natural disaster'
China Daily | Updated: 2018-07-25 07:50
Govt spokesman: Urgent measures are needed to protect children
TOKYO - Japan logged its highest ever temperature on Monday, as a heat wave continued to scorch wide swathes of the country, killing dozens in what the weather agency classified as a "natural disaster".
At least nine people died in seven prefectures and 1,843 people were sent to hospitals on Monday, according to Kyodo News.
